On Fri, 2003-08-08 at 01:21, Tomas Szepe wrote:

> > This is no longer true.
> > There is sort of "universal" fs convertor for linux that can convert almost
> > any fs to almost any other fs.
> > The only requirement seems to be that both fs types should have read/write support in Linux.
> > http://tzukanov.narod.ru/convertfs/
> 
> I'm afraid I cannot recommend using this tool.
> 
> A test conversion from reiserfs to ext3 (inside a vmware machine)
> screwed up the data real horrorshow: directory structure seems
> ok but file contents are apparently shifted.

I'm looking at converting (sometime soon) a JFS system to XFS using
convertfs, I'm hoping this "converting" process will come out bug-free. 
Other than backing up all the data, and re-formating to XFS, would any
one have suggestings?

convertfs /dev/hde1 jfs xfs
